服务器架子叫什么

worktile 其他 23

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    服务器架构是指服务器系统的硬件组成和软件体系结构。它是为了满足特定需求而设计的一种计算机系统布局和组织方式。服务器架构的选择主要取决于应用领域、业务规模、性能需求和可用资源等因素。

    常见的服务器架构包括以下几种:

    1. 单机架构:单机架构是最基本的服务器架构形式。它通常指的是将所有的服务器软件和硬件都集中在一台物理服务器上。这种架构适用于小型应用或测试环境,具有成本低、管理简单等优点。但是单机架构的性能和可靠性有限,不适合大型和高并发的场景。

    2. 分布式架构:分布式架构通过将系统的工作任务分发到多个服务器上来实现扩展性和性能的提升。分布式架构采用了服务器集群的概念,可以通过增加服务器的数量来提高系统的并发处理能力。分布式架构适用于高并发、大数据量、高可用性的应用场景,例如电商平台、社交网络等。

    3. 客户端-服务器架构:客户端-服务器架构是一种常见的网络应用架构。它将系统分为两个部分,客户端负责用户界面和业务逻辑处理,服务器负责存储数据和处理业务请求。客户端-服务器架构适用于需要多个客户端同时访问和共享数据的场景,例如Web应用、邮件服务器等。

    4. 云计算架构:云计算架构是基于云计算技术的一种服务模式。它可以提供按需分配、弹性扩展的资源服务。云计算架构包括私有云、公有云和混合云等不同形式。云计算架构适用于需要大规模计算和存储资源的应用,可以提供高可用性和可扩展性。

    总结来说,服务器架构是根据应用需求和性能要求选择的一种计算机系统组织方式。常见的服务器架构包括单机架构、分布式架构、客户端-服务器架构和云计算架构。根据实际情况选择合适的服务器架构可以提高系统的性能、可靠性和可扩展性。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    服务器架构是指服务器的组织结构和设计方式。它决定了服务器的性能、可扩展性和可靠性。常见的服务器架构包括以下几种:

    1. 单机型架构(Traditional Monolithic Architecture):这是最简单的服务器架构,所有的功能都运行在一个单独的服务器上。该架构适用于小规模应用,易于管理和维护,但在处理大量用户或复杂任务时会存在性能瓶颈。

    2. 分布式架构(Distributed Architecture):分布式架构将服务器划分为多个独立的节点,每个节点都具有独立的计算和存储资源。节点之间通过网络进行通信和协作。这种架构可以实现高可扩展性和高可用性,但需要复杂的管理和调度。

    3. 服务导向架构(Service-Oriented Architecture, SOA):SOA是一种基于服务的架构,通过将应用程序划分为独立的、可重用的服务来提供功能。这些服务可以通过网络进行访问和调用,可以实现跨平台和跨语言的集成。

    4. 容器化架构(Containerization Architecture):容器化架构使用容器技术将应用程序和其依赖项打包在一起。每个容器都是一个独立的运行环境,具有自己的文件系统、进程和资源隔离。容器可以快速部署、扩展和管理,提供了更高的灵活性和可移植性。

    5. 云架构(Cloud Architecture):云架构是基于云计算技术的服务器架构,通过将计算和存储资源放置在云服务提供商的数据中心中,实现按需提供、弹性伸缩和资源共享。云架构提供了高度灵活的资源管理和服务交付模式,可以根据需求快速调整服务器规模。

    这些服务器架构都有各自的优缺点和适用场景,选择适合的架构取决于具体应用的需求和目标。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    服务器架构是指在服务器系统中,为满足特定的需求和目标所设计和构建的一种结构。它涵盖了服务器的硬件配置、软件系统、网络架构和安全措施等方面。

    一、单机架构
    单机架构是最简单的服务器架构。在单机架构中,服务器由一台独立的计算机(物理服务器)组成,负责处理所有的任务。单机架构适用于小型网站或应用,具有简单的部署和管理方式。

    二、集群架构
    集群架构是将多台服务器通过网络连接在一起,一起共同处理用户请求。集群架构可以提高系统的可用性和性能。常见的集群架构包括负载均衡集群和高可用集群。

    1. 负载均衡集群:负载均衡集群通过将用户请求均匀地分发到不同的服务器上,来实现并行处理和提高系统的性能。常见的负载均衡策略有轮询、最少连接数、源IP哈希等。

    2. 高可用集群:高可用集群一般由两台以上的服务器组成,其中一台为主服务器处理用户请求,其余服务器为备份服务器,当主服务器故障时,备份服务器将接管用户请求,确保系统的可用性。

    三、分布式架构
    分布式架构是将应用程序的不同功能模块分布到多台服务器上进行处理,可以通过网络连接进行通信和协调。分布式架构具有良好的可扩展性和容错性,并可以实现并行处理和资源共享。

    常见的分布式架构包括微服务架构、大数据架构等,如微服务架构将应用程序拆分成多个小型的独立服务,各服务之间通过API进行通信;大数据架构将大数据分布到多台服务器上进行存储和处理,以提高数据处理的效率和速度。

    四、云计算架构
    云计算架构是基于云计算技术构建的服务器架构,可以将计算资源、存储资源和应用程序等虚拟化并提供给用户使用。云计算架构具有灵活、可扩展、高可用和弹性伸缩等特点。

    云计算架构包括IaaS(基础设施即服务)、PaaS(平台即服务)和SaaS(软件即服务)等模式。其中,IaaS提供基础设施资源(如服务器、存储和网络等);PaaS提供应用程序开发和运行的平台;SaaS提供已经搭建好的软件应用服务。

    总结:
    服务器架构根据不同的需求和目标可以选择单机架构、集群架构、分布式架构和云计算架构等。选择恰当的服务器架构可以提高系统的可用性、性能和扩展性。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部